Als «python» getaggte Fragen

122
Fügen Sie dem Array in numpy ein einzelnes Element hinzu

Ich habe ein numpy Array mit: [1, 2, 3] Ich möchte ein Array erstellen, das Folgendes enthält: [1, 2, 3, 1] Das heißt, ich möchte das erste Element am Ende des Arrays hinzufügen. Ich habe das Offensichtliche versucht: np.concatenate((a, a[0])) Aber ich bekomme eine Fehlermeldung ValueError: arrays...

122
Drehen eines zweidimensionalen Arrays in Python

In einem Programm, das ich schreibe, kam die Notwendigkeit auf, ein zweidimensionales Array zu drehen. Auf der Suche nach der optimalen Lösung habe ich diesen beeindruckenden Einzeiler gefunden, der die Aufgabe erfüllt: rotated = zip(*original[::-1]) Ich benutze es jetzt in meinem Programm und es...

122
Python: Wert in einem Tupel ändern

Ich bin neu in Python, daher könnte diese Frage ein wenig grundlegend sein. Ich habe ein Tupel namens values, das Folgendes enthält: ('275', '54000', '0.0', '5000.0', '0.0') Ich möchte den ersten Wert (dh 275) in diesem Tupel ändern, aber ich verstehe, dass Tupel unveränderlich sind und daher...

122
Ausführen des Python-Skripts in ipython

Ist es möglich, ein Python-Skript (kein Modul) in ipython auszuführen, ohne dessen Pfad anzugeben? Ich habe versucht, PYTHONPATH einzustellen, aber es scheint nur für Module zu funktionieren. Ich würde gerne ausführen %run my_script.py ohne in dem Verzeichnis zu sein, das die Datei...

122
Was ist der Unterschied zwischen "Inhalt" und "Text"?

Ich benutze die großartige Python Requests- Bibliothek. Ich stelle fest, dass die gute Dokumentation viele Beispiele dafür enthält, wie man etwas macht, ohne das Warum zu erklären . Beispielsweise werden beide r.textund r.contentals Beispiele für das Abrufen der Serverantwort angezeigt . Aber wo...

122
__init__ für unittest.TestCase

Ich möchte ein paar Dinge zu dem hinzufügen, was die unittest.TestCaseKlasse nach der Initialisierung tut, aber ich kann nicht herausfinden, wie es geht. Im Moment mache ich das: #filename test.py class TestingClass(unittest.TestCase): def __init__(self): self.gen_stubs() def gen_stubs(self): #...

122
Pandas groupby: Wie man eine Vereinigung von Saiten bekommt

Ich habe einen Datenrahmen wie diesen: A B C 0 1 0.749065 This 1 2 0.301084 is 2 3 0.463468 a 3 4 0.643961 random 4 1 0.866521 string 5 2 0.120737 ! Berufung In [10]: print df.groupby("A")["B"].sum() wird zurückkehren A 1 1.615586 2 0.421821 3 0.463468 4 0.643961 Jetzt möchte ich "dasselbe" für...